After her son was diagnosed with Autism Spectrum Disorder in 2023, LeQui knew how important it was for other families to have resources and support for their loved ones on the spectrum. Navigating through this journey with her son was challenging as there weren't many assistance programs and resources she was aware were availabe. Nehemiah's Place™ has become an anchor for families, through education and support.
In 2025, LeQui Gandy was also diagnosed with Autism Spectrum Disorder. Throughout her life, she always felt different, navigating challenges with forming friendships, communicating directly, and building relationships. These experiences have shaped her perspective, resilience, and understanding of herself and the world around her. With this diagnosis, she is determined to spread awareness and provide continued support to adults just like her.
With a Bachelor’s Degree in Criminal Justice and years of hands-on experience in the field, LeQui Gandy joined the Franklin County Sheriff’s Office (Ohio) in 2024. She serves as a Pre-Employment and Background Investigations Officer, where she leveraged her extensive human resources expertise and criminal justice background. In this role, LeQui has played a pivotal part in developing strategies, standards, and operational frameworks that have been successfully integrated into the newly established Recruitment,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ion (RDEI) Division.
Beyond her contributions to law enforcement, LeQui has always been deeply committed to children's education and community empowerment. She is an active advocate for Autism Spectrum Disorder through her non-profit organization, Nehemiah’s Place™, Founder of COFO Agency, a nonprofit organization dedicated to supporting school-aged children, and a dedicated public school teacher. Her passion for mentorship and service shines through her work—whether developing impactful workshops and programs or volunteering as a coach for elementary school basketball.
Further extending her influence, LeQui was appointed Program Administrator for Urban Aviators Society, a role that allows her to merge her love for education and youth development. Through this initiative, she is committed to nurturing and empowering the next generation of aviation scholars, ensuring they have the tools and support needed to excel in the field.

Brittany Mathews was born in Columbus, Ohio, and currently resides in San Diego, California. She is no stranger to individuals on the autism spectrum; her nephew was diagnosed with Level 2 Autism in 2012, allowing her to witness firsthand the challenges that accompany such a diagnosis.
Brittany’s deep understanding and genuine care for others have guided her focus on family support, community engagement, and awareness. In 2014, her son, Isaac, was diagnosed with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D), further strengthening her compassion for children with special needs. Navigating the daily challenges of raising a child with ADHD inspired Brittany to pursue a leadership role, and she now serves as Vice President of Nehemiah’s Place.

Originally from East Orange, New Jersey, Demetrius Samuel earned his bachelor’s degree from North Carolina A&T State University and later pursued his master’s degree at Wright State University in Fairborn, Ohio. No stranger to the field of special education, Mr. Samuel’s passion is deeply personal.
His youngest child, Kaori, born in 2024, was diagnosed with Trisomy 13, a rare genetic disorder. Despite her challenges, Kaori is a remarkably strong child. She is tracheostomy- and G-tube–dependent, has a congenital heart defect, and was born without the corpus callosum of her brain. She is blind, yet finds joy in listening to basketball, football, Storage Wars, and HGTV.
Having been hospitalized since birth, Kaori will celebrate her first birthday on January 29, 2026. Demetrius joined the Board to help spread awareness and education about individuals with special needs—a mission that is closer to his heart than most.
